This is the first of three volumes on algebraic geometry. Most algebraic geometers are well-versed in the language of schemes, but many newcomers are still initially hesitant about them. Ueno's book provides an introduction to the theory, which should overcome any such impediment to learning this rich subject.

The word moduli in the sense of this book first appeared in the epoch-making paper of B. Riemann, Theorie der Abel'schen Funktionen, published in 1857. Riemann defined a Riemann surface of an algebraic function field as a branched covering of a one-dimensional complex projective space, and found out that Riemann surfaces have parameters.

Discusses the theory of trigonometric and elliptic functions. This book includes subjects such as power series expansions, addition and multiple-angle formulas, and arithmetic-geometric means. It describes various aspects of the Poncelet Closure Theorem.

This is a timely introduction to an intensively studied topic of conformal field theory with gauge symmetry by a leading algebraic geometer, and includes all the necessary techniques and results that are used to construct the modular functor.

Algebraic geometry plays an important role in several branches of science and technology. This book discusses dimension theory, flat and proper morphisms, regular schemes, smooth morphisms, completion, and Zariski's main theorem. It also presents the theory of algebraic curves and their Jacobians.

This book will bring the beauty and fun of learning mathematics to the classroom. It offers serious mathematics in a lively, reader-friendly style. Included are exercises and many figures that illustrate the main concepts. The first chapter presents the geometry and topology of surfaces. Among other topics, the authors discuss the Poincare-Hopf theorem on critical points of vector fields on surfaces and the Gauss-Bonnet theorem on the relation between curvature and topology (the Euler characteristics).
